Opobo–Nkoro (also spelled Opobo/Nkoro) is a Local Government Area in Rivers State, Nigeria. It is part of the Andoni/Opobo/nkoro constituency of
the Nigerian National Assembly delegation from Rivers. The capital is Opobo Town. The Opobo–Nkoro people are mainly farmers and
fishermen.They are of Igbo extraction. They speak
Igbo language. Just like the neighbouring Bonny,
founded by Ndokis of Azuogu, slaves from the
hinterland transformed the demography of the
area when the Transatlantic Slave Trade was abolished. Ijaws who came in as porters also
settled there and the Igbo language was adopted.
Although, there are no indigenous Ijaw
communities there, most Ijaw migrants and porters
have fully been integrated into the original
indigenous Igbo communities. Pro-Natura International Nigeria has been assisting in community-led development in the LGA.

The opobo's are a factional group that broke out from Bonny. They are 100% ijaws and 0% Igbo. Although the founder of opobo kingdom is an Igbo man but his subject's are ijaws. The Igbo language the people of opobo and bonny speak is as a result of their settling in obibo when they were migrating from Wilberforce island amasoma in bayelsa. They settled at obibo (IMO river) that was were they learnt the Igbo language.
